Customs urges commitment to the National Single Window project

The Nigerian Customs Service (NCS) has called for commitment from all stakeholders to ensure the successful implementation of the National Single Window (NSW) initiative aimed at simplifying Nigeria’s import and export processes through a unified digital platform. The Zonal Coordinator for Zone ‘A’, Assistant Comptroller General (ACG) Mohammed Babandede, made the call at the National One Window Stakeholder Engagement Forum …

NGX: Dangote Cement, NEM lead gainers as Investors made N497 billion in five hours

Investors in the Nigerian equity market earned N308 billion at the close of trading on Thursday. This follows the soaring prices of shares such as Dangote Cement, NEM Insurance and Jaiz Bank Plc among others on the stock exchange floor. The benchmark All-Share Index (ASI) jumped to 146,988.04 points from 146,204.33 points recorded the previous day. After five hours of …
